    What is Zetia 10 mg?

    Zetia 10 mg, also known as ezetimibe, is a prescription medication used to lower cholesterol levels in the blood. It belongs to a class of drugs called cholesterol absorption inhibitors, which work by reducing the amount of cholesterol absorbed by the body from food. Zetia 10 mg is often prescribed in conjunction with other cholesterol-lowering medications, such as statins, to achieve optimal results.

    Understanding High Cholesterol

    High cholesterol, also known as hypercholesterolemia, occurs when there is an excessive amount of cholesterol in the blood. Cholesterol is a type of fat that is essential for various bodily functions, such as the production of hormones and the maintenance of healthy cells. However, when cholesterol levels become too high, it can lead to the buildup of plaque in the arteries, increasing the risk of cardiovascular disease.

    There are two types of cholesterol: low-density lipoprotein (LDL) and high-density lipoprotein (HDL). LDL cholesterol is often referred to as "bad" cholesterol, as it contributes to the buildup of plaque in the arteries. On the other hand, HDL cholesterol is considered "good" cholesterol, as it helps remove excess cholesterol from the bloodstream.

    The Benefits of a Low-Fat Diet

    A low-fat diet is an essential component of treating high cholesterol. By reducing the amount of fat in your diet, you can lower your LDL cholesterol levels and increase your HDL cholesterol levels. A low-fat diet can also help you maintain a healthy weight, which is important for overall health and well-being.

    The following table highlights the benefits of a low-fat diet in treating high cholesterol:

    Dietary Component Effect on Cholesterol Levels
    Saturated fats Increase LDL cholesterol
    Trans fats Increase LDL cholesterol and decrease HDL cholesterol
    Monounsaturated fats Lower LDL cholesterol and increase HDL cholesterol
    Polyunsaturated fats Lower LDL cholesterol and increase HDL cholesterol
    Soluble fiber Lower LDL cholesterol

    Tips for Incorporating a Low-Fat Diet into Your Daily Life

    Incorporating a low-fat diet into your daily life can be challenging, but with the following tips, you can make sustainable changes:

    1. Choose lean protein sources: Opt for lean protein sources, such as poultry, fish, and legumes, instead of red meat and full-fat dairy products.
    2. Eat more fruits and vegetables: Fruits and vegetables are rich in fiber, vitamins, and minerals, and are low in fat.
    3. Select whole grains: Whole grains, such as brown rice, quinoa, and whole-wheat bread, are rich in fiber and nutrients.
    4. Use healthy fats: Use healthy fats, such as olive oil and avocado, instead of saturated and trans fats.
    5. Limit processed foods: Processed foods are often high in fat, salt, and sugar, and low in essential nutrients.

    The following list provides additional tips for reducing fat intake:

    • Read food labels: Check the nutrition label to ensure that the food product is low in fat and high in fiber.
    • Cook at home: Cooking at home allows you to control the amount of fat used in meal preparation.
    • Avoid fried foods: Fried foods are high in fat and calories, and should be limited or avoided.
    • Choose low-fat dairy products: Opt for low-fat or fat-free dairy products, such as milk and yogurt.
